Configuring common services

The common services minimize the data integration effort between Sterling Order Management System Software and external systems. After the tenant settings, nodes, distribution groups, and catalog capabilities are configured, data is synchronized internally across all IBM® Sterling Intelligent Promising services.

Before you begin

Ensure that you are familiar with the following concepts:

Default tenant settings
Default tenant settings are applied to your account as part of the provisioning process, if necessary you can change these settings. For more information, see Default tenant settings.
Node types
Node types are locations where inventory is stored. The default node types are distribution center and store. For more information, see Node types.
Nodes
Fulfillment nodes are locations where inventory is stored. For more information, see Nodes.
Distribution groups
Distribution groups include a network of fulfillment centers or nodes. These groups are used for network availability or sourcing restrictions. For more information, see Distribution groups.

Procedure

Configure the common services to define nodes and distribution groups across your fulfillment network.

  1. Configure the values for the default tenant settings for your account by using the Define settings API.
  2. Configure node types to define common node configurations for sourcing purposes or assign node types to a shipping node by using an API or the UI:
    Configuration option Procedure
    API Define node type
    Order Hub Managing node types
  3. Configure nodes to specify the fulfillment locations for orders by using an API or the UI:
    Configuration option Procedure
    API Define node
    Order Hub Configuring nodes
  4. Configure distribution groups to associate your inventory with nodes by using an API or the UI:
    Configuration option Procedure
    API Define distribution group
    Order Hub Configuring distribution groups for inventory
